2015-01-06 187 views
3

未能在項目'android'中設置Android模塊:不支持的方法:BaseArtifact.getJavaCompileTaskName()。您連接的Gradle版本不支持該方法。 要解決此問題,您可以更改/升級您連接到的Gradle的target versionUnsupportedMethodException Android Studio(Beta)0.8.6

或者,您可以忽略此Exception並從模型中讀取其他信息。

你能幫我解決嗎?

+1

還有一個AndroidStudio 1.0.2以外的穩定版本。我可以問你爲什麼使用舊的測試版? – Blackbelt

+0

謝謝! @Blackbelt – 1911192110920

回答

0
buildTypes { 
     release { 
      //minifyEnabled false 
      runProguard false 
      pro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ro' 
     } 
    } 

裏面你「的build.gradle」的文件,如果你有「minifyEnabled假」,評論說出來,見好就收「runProguard假」。看到我上面的示例代碼。

+1

runProguard已在android工具1.x中更改爲minifyEnabled。 http://tools.android.com/tech-docs/new-build-system/migrating-to-1-0-0 – Grasshopper

0

您需要打開項目結構或模塊設置並更正gradle版本,或者您可以更正build.gradle文件中的gradle版本。

對於您的Android Studio版本,您需要具有gradle版本1.12。我遇到了同樣的問題,並通過從2.2.1更新gradle版本到1.12來修復它。

相關問題